Address

tb1qdpa8dpthaqdna7q29hfqrav3fz7p7y5yefekzjCopy

Total Received

38.44948753 TBTC

Total Sent

38.44948753 TBTC

№ Transactions

2

Final Balance

0 TBTC

Transactions
Filter